WHERE ARE THEY! | Batman The Telltale Series | Episode 3 New World Order

WHERE ARE THEY! | Batman The Telltale Series | Episode 3 New World Order

Checkout my other videos here! -    / @samtuckett   Checkout my Twitch here! -   / xiowz